My wife had casserole trauma when she was a kid, so this recipe is reserved for when she's out of town.

I get the "instant" Lasagna noodles, the ones you don't have to boil first.
I basically follow the recipe on the box, but if I can get it, I use ground buffalo. I sweat the greens--you could use swisschard or any braising green instead of or in addition to spinach--in some olive oil, garlic, salt, and pepper.

Just layer some nice sauce on the bottom of the dish, lay some noodles in, cover with ricotta, meat, greens. Repeat until done.

Bake until bubbly and delicious.

I just found a great glaze for chicken. It comes from Cook's Illustrated and is made thusly:

1/2 c. maple syrup (I used fig because maple is hard to find here)
1/2 c. marmalade (recipe calls for orange, I used lemon)
1/4 c. cider vinegar
2 Tbsp butter
1 tsp corn starch dissolved in 1 tbsp water

Cook the syrup, marmalade, butter, and vinegar until it starts to thicken and caramelize a little, then add the cornstarch mixture and cook for a minute to thicken.

I just grilled 5 quartered chickens for a party, and the glaze went over really well. It reminds me of Chinese, with the contrasting sweet and sour tastes, but that impression may be because I haven't had Chinese food for almost a year :)
